When? Meeting date will be the 2nd Monday in the month
Where? Meeting on Zoom except for external visits
We continue to use zoom for our meetings at the moment and have enjoyed some very interesting talks, both by members and one of our favourite speakers, John Cosier. He has given us 'The Particle Zoo', 'The Life Cycle of Stars' and 2 talks on Chernobyl. He makes the subjects come to life, his talks are fascinating and informative.
We also enjoyed a guided tour of the Science area at Wisley gardens, a guided tour of East Grinstead Museum and a Summer Social in Kay's garden.
